        AN  ACT  to  amend  the civil practice law and rules, in relation to how
          certain parties shall be designated; and to  repeal  section  1019  of
          such law relating to the substitution of public officers

          THE  P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M-
        B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:

     1    Section 1. Section 1019  of  the  civil  practice  law  and  rules  is
     2  REPEALED.
     3    §  2.  Section  1023 of the civil practice law and rules is amended to
     4  read as follows:
     5    § 1023. Public body or officer described by  official  title.  When  a
     6  public  officer,  body, board, commission or other public agency may sue
     7  or be sued in its official capacity, [it  may]  THAT  PERSON  OR  ENTITY
     8  SHALL be designated by [its] THE official title, subject to the power of
     9  the court to require names to be added.
    10    §  3. This act shall take effect on the first of January next succeed-
    11  ing the date on which it shall have become a law and shall apply to  all
    12  actions pending on or after such effective date.






         EXPLANATION--Matter in ITALICS (underscored) is new; matter in brackets
                              [ ] is old law to be omitted.
